Ozark, MO Gun Crime Lawyer: Missouri Gun Laws
While Ozark, MO upholds the constitutional right to bear arms, allowing open carry and issuing concealed carry permits under defined conditions, there are important restrictions to be aware of:
- Use of a Firearm: Displaying a firearm in a threatening way or using it during the commission of a crime can result in serious legal consequences.
- Restricted Zones: Firearms are prohibited in schools, courthouses, and other designated zones unless authorized.
- Restricted Individuals: Convicted felons, individuals with certain domestic violence convictions, and those under orders of protection may not own or possess firearms.

Unlawful Use of a Weapon
Missouri laws on unlawful use of a weapon cover several situations in Ozark, MO, such as:
- Discharging a firearm in certain areas, including firing a gun while intoxicated.
- Displaying a firearm in a menacing or threatening way.
- Carrying a concealed weapon in Ozark, MO without proper authorization.
- Possessing a firearm in Ozark, MO prohibited areas.
- Using a weapon during the commission of a crime, such as robbery or assault in the Ozark, MO area.
- Making illegal alterations or attachments to firearms.
Penalties for unlawful use of a weapon vary, from a Class B misdemeanor, punishable by up to 6 months in jail and fines, to a Class A felony, which can carry a prison sentence of 10 to life.

Unlawful Possession of a Firearm
Missouri Revised Statute § 571.070 outlines the circumstances under which possession of a firearm becomes unlawful, including:
- Possession by a Felon
- Possession by Minors
- Possession by Certain Offenders
- Federal Firearm Restrictions
Unlawful possession of a firearm is a Class C felony, unless an individual has been convicted of a dangerous felony or has prior unlawful possession charges in Ozark, MO or beyond, which elevate the offense to a Class B felony.

Armed Criminal Action
Armed criminal action is a serious offense in Ozark, MO involving the use, display, or possession of a weapon during the commission of a felony. This charge enhances the severity of the primary felony, such as assault, burglary, robbery, or drug trafficking. For example, someone committing a burglary while armed could face both robbery and armed criminal action charges.
Missouri law treats armed criminal action as a separate felony with mandatory sentencing requirements – 3 years for a first offense, 5 years for a second, and 10 years for a third. These stringent penalties require the expertise of an experienced Ozark, MO defense lawyer who can:

Unlawful Transfer of Weapons
The unlawful transfer of weapons in Ozark, MO involves selling, loaning, leasing, giving away, or otherwise providing firearms or other weapons to individuals who are legally prohibited from owning or possessing them.
An unlawful transfer of weapons charge is a Class A misdemeanor or a Class E felony, depending on the severity of the case. Possession of a Defaced Firearm
Possessing a firearm with defaced markings, such as removed or altered serial numbers, is a criminal offense. Authorities in Ozark, MO consider possession of a defaced firearm a serious matter due to its association with criminal activity, including stolen weapons. Under Missouri law, this offense is classified as a Class B misdemeanor.

Ozark, MO Gun Crime Lawyer: Understanding Federal Gun Crimes in Missouri
Ozark, MO gun crimes can sometimes escalate to federal offenses, bringing harsher penalties and stricter enforcement. Federal gun charges often come into play when:
- The crime involves crossing state lines.
- The firearm was used in a federal crime, such as drug trafficking, terrorism, or a violent offense crossing state lines.
- Cases include serious factors such as organized crime affiliations or large-scale arms trafficking.
Ozark, MO Gun Crime Lawyer: Challenging Gun Crime Charges in Missouri
The Combs Waterkotte criminal defense attorneys in Ozark, MO, employ several effective strategies to counter gun crime charges. Common defenses include:
- Lack of Intent or Awareness
For a conviction in Ozark, MO, prosecutors must prove you acted knowingly. We might argue that you were unaware of the firearm’s presence or lacked intent to commit a crime. - Illegal Search & Seizure
The Fourth Amendment protects against unreasonable searches and seizures. If Ozark, MO law enforcement violated your rights when obtaining evidence, discovering a gun through an unlawful stop or frisk or search of your vehicle or residence. - Self-Defense
Missouri law allows the use of force, including deadly force, in self-defense if you reasonably believed you were in imminent danger of harm or death and the use of force was necessary to prevent that harm.
